A STUDY OF UNEVEN WEAR IN COMMUTATORS

Mathematical study using a diagrammatical test model of the phenomenon. The effects of mechanical wear that tends to develop in the commutator surface, which corresponds to the variations and is due to strains in the brushes, is represented by a Fourier series based on the angular velocity of the motor. The electric wear profile is also described. The author reaches conclusions about ways to lengthen commutator life.
